You could use the isosceles triangle theorems. if two sides of a triangle are congruent, then then angles opposite those sides are congruent. so if the two sides of the triangle are congruent (which they should be if it’s an isosceles triangle) then the isosceles triangle theorem proves that the base angles are congruent

Answer:
0.25
Step-by-step explanation:
Givens
orange: 75
Blue: 62
Green: 52
Red: x
Total: 252
Equation
75 + 62 + 52 + x = 252 Collect the like terms on the left.
Solution
189 + x = 252 Subtract 189 from both sides
x = 252 - 189
x = 63 Red Ones
Probability
P(Red) = 63/252
P(Red) = 0.25
